Prediction and Analysis of Abnormal Gas Emission Law in Low-Gas Tunnel Based on K-Line Diagram

摘要
The risk of gas disaster in the low-gas tunnel is easy to be ignored. By tracking and analyzing the gas monitoring data of the low-gas tunnel, it is found that the cyclic abnormal gas emission occurred many times during the construction period, leading to local gas accumulation, which greatly increases the risk of gas explosion accidents. To scientifically predict the abnormal gas emission in low-gas tunnels, the idea of K-line diagram-based prediction of abnormal gas emission in low-gas tunnels is put forward, and in combination with the field monitoring data of low-gas tunnel (Huangguashan Tunnel), the prediction results with different prediction indexes of K-line diagram are compared and analyzed. The results show that the K-line diagram can reflect the changing trend of gas concentration in real time accurately and show the change law of gas concentration during different construction processes; the moving average (MA) of the K-line diagram can accurately reflect the time of abnormal gas emission, the moving average convergence divergence (MACD) index can reflect the upward or downward power and trend of gas, and the Bollinger Band (BOLL) index can reflect the fluctuation range of gas concentration. The research results can provide a reference for the prediction and prevention of abnormal gas emission in low-gas tunnels.
